About Astra Graphia Tbk

PT Astra Graphia Tbk (the Company) was established in Indonesia on October 31, 1975 based on notarial deed No. 186 of Notary Kartini Muljadi, S.H. PT. Astra Graphia started its operations in 1975 as a member of Astra group (Xerox Division) and in 1976 Xerox division was incorporated as a separate entity under the name of PT Astra Graphia. The company core business is acting as sole distributor for several products in document and information services. The company is domestic investment.

About Intikeramik Alamasri Industri Tbk.

PT Intikeramik Alamasri Industri Tbk (the Company) was established under the name PT Intikeramik Alamasri Indah based on notarial deed No. 38 dated June 26, 1991 and was amended with notarial deed No. 16 dated December 14, 1991, both made by Raden Muhammad Hendarmawan, S.H., Notary in Jakarta. PT Intikeramik Alamasri Industri Tbk is the pioneer of large-scale porcelain tile manufacture in Indonesia and one of the largest producers in the Asia Pacific region. Porcelain tiles are superior in term of strength, durability and design versatility to natural stone as well as other synthetics such as glazed tiles. Porcelain is attractive and affordable for use in both commercial and residential developments and has strong following among international architects and interior designers. Intikeramik is seeking to build a leading profile in markets across Europe, America and Asia drawing upon its reputation for consistency, advanced manufacturing technology, a low cost base and substantial available capacity. The company has consolidation production capacity 6,600,000 m2 /year.
